The Fine Arts Building was originally intended to house a television studio, as well as the Departments of Music, Dance, Theatre, and Visual Arts. Eventually English, Philosophy, Ancient Studies, and American Studies were located there. When the Performing Arts and Humanities Building was completed in 2014, many of the departments originally in Fine Arts moved to the new building; the Fine Arts Building underwent major renovation during 2014 to 2016, and the departments of History, Africana Studies, Gender & Women's Studies, Judaic Studies, Global Studies, Religious Studies, Modern Languages, and Literature and Intercultural Communications moved into new spaces there.
